Tải bản đầy đủ (.docx) (2 trang)

FILE KỊCH BẢN – TẠO CSDL QLY_SINHVIEN

Bạn đang xem bản rút gọn của tài liệu. Xem và tải ngay bản đầy đủ của tài liệu tại đây (80.71 KB, 2 trang )

<span class='text_page_counter'>(1)</span><div class='page_container' data-page=1>

<b>BÀI TẬP THỰC HÀNH SỐ 2</b>


<b> Sử dụng CSDL QLY_DIEMSV, tạo Batch Query thực hiện các yêu cầu sau:</b>
<b>1. Hiển thị Mã sinh viên, Họ, Tên, Giới tính 0: Nữ; 1: Nam; Null khơng có.</b>
<b>2. Hiển thị danh sách gồm Họ Tên, Ngày sinh dạng ‘dd/mm/yyyy’</b>


<b>3. Cho biết tổng số sinh viên hiện có trong bảng SINHVIEN</b>
<b>4. Hiển thị các Khoa có lớp học</b>


<b>5. Hiển thị danh sách gồm MaSV, HoTen, Malop của những sinh viên lớp ‘CT11’,</b>
CT12’


<b>6. Hiển thị danh sách sinh viên có họ là Lê</b>


<b>7. Cho biết những sinh viên có họ bắt đầu bằng N,L,T</b>
<b>8. Hiển thị danh sách sinh viên nữ lớp CT11 và CT12.</b>
<b>9. Hiển thị danh sách sinh viên không ở lớp CT11.</b>
<b>10. Hiển thị danh sách 5 sinh viên có tuổi cao nhất.</b>
<b>11. Hiển thị số lượng sinh viên học lớp CT11.</b>


<b>12. Hiển thị danh sách sinh viên nữ có sinh trước năm 1995</b>
<b>13. Hiển thị danh sách sinh viên có DiemMH <5</b>


<b>14. Vẫn câu hỏi trên nhưng hiển thị thêm cột Khoahoc</b>
<b>15. Đếm số lượng sinh viên của mỗi lớp</b>


<b>16. Vẫn câu hỏi 15, Hiển thị thêm vùng TenLop ở bảng DMLOP.</b>
<b>17. Đưa ra danh sách những lớp có tổng số sinh viên >10</b>


<b>18. Tính Điểm Trung bình chung học kỳ theo từng sinh viên. Xuất dữ liệu ra bảng </b>
mới có tên DIEMTBC



<b>19. Cho biết những sinh viên có ít nhất 2 mơn học có DiemMH <5</b>
<b>20. Vẫn câu 19, Thêm vùng: Ho, Ten, Lop.</b>


<b>21. Tính Điểm trung bình chung của các học kỳ cho từng sinh viên.</b>


<b>22. Cho biết những sinh viên có tổng số đơn vị học trình của các mơn thiếu điểm </b>
trên 25 (sinh viên ở lại lớp)


<b>23. Cho biết những sinh viên có Điểm TK các mơn học <3 (ở lại lớp).</b>
<b>24. Đếm số sinh viên Nam, Nữ của lớp CT11</b>


<b>25. Đếm số sinh viên Nam, Nữ của từng lớp.</b>


<b>26. Cho biết giáo viên dạy ít nhất 2 mơn học. Bổ sung thêm bảng </b>
GIAOVIEN(MaGV, HoTen, Dienthoai, MonGDay)


<b>27. Cho biết giáo viên dạy ít nhất 2 mơn học ‘001’ và ‘002’. (Lọc ra những giáo </b>
viên dạy ít nhất một môn ‘001 và ‘002’, Đếm số số môn dạy của từng giáo viên
với đk tổng số môn dạy =2)


<b>28. Cho biết MaSV học tất cả các môn học. (Đếm số mơn học của từng sinh viên, </b>
có tổng số lượng bằng tổng số lượng của các môn học)


<b>29. Cho biết Tên sinh viên có ít nhất 2 mơn học có DiemMH <5</b>
<b>30. Cho biết Tên lớp có sinh viên tên Hoa</b>


<b>31. Cho biết Tên Mơn học khơng có sinh viên thiếu điểm MH</b>


<i><b>32. Cho biết danh sách các mơn học có số đơn vị học trình lớn hơn hoặc bằng số </b></i>


<i>đơn vị học trình của mơn học có mã là 001</i>


<b>33. Cho biết Mã sinh viên có DiemMH lớn nhất</b>


<b>34. Nghĩa là lớn hơn hoặc bằng tất cả các giá trị điểm của tập DiemMH</b>


</div>
<span class='text_page_counter'>(2)</span><div class='page_container' data-page=2>

<b>36. Cho biết họ tên của những sinh viên hiện chưa có điểm thi của bất kỳ một mơn </b>
học nào?


<b>37. Cho biết mã sinh viên đã học ít nhất một mơn có mã là “001”, “002”</b>
<b>38. Cho biết Mã sinh viên chưa học môn nào</b>


<b>39. Cho biết Mã sinh viên học cả hai mơn có mã ‘001’ và ‘002’</b>
<b>40. Cho biết Mã môn học mà chưa được học</b>


<b>41. Cho biết Tên môn học mà chưa được học.</b>


<b>42. Cho biết Mã giáo viên dạy cả hai mơn có mã ‘001’ và ‘002’</b>
<b>43. Cho biết Tên giáo viên dạy cả hai mơn có mã ‘001’ và ‘002’.</b>
<b>44. Cho biết Mã giáo viên dạy mơn học có số đơn vị học trình >=5.</b>
<b>45. Cho biết Masv học ít nhất một học do giáo viên mã ‘001’.</b>


<b>46. Thêm cột Xếp loại trong bảng DIEMTBC, Cập nhật dữ liệu cho cột đó theo yêu</b>
cầu sau:


<b>47. Đếm số sinh viên nữ lớp CT11</b>
<b>48. Đếm số sinh viên nam, nữ lớp CT11</b>


<b>49. Cho biết những sinh viên có họ khơng bắt đầu bằng N,L,T</b>
<b>50. Hiển thị danh sách sinh viên không ở lớp CT11.</b>



<b>51. Hiển thị danh sách 5 sinh viên có tuổi cao nhất.</b>
<b>52. Cho biết những lớp có tổng số sv >7</b>


<b>53. Cho biết những sinh viên có ít nhất 2 mơn học có DiemMH <5</b>


<b>54. Cho biết những sinh viên có tổng số đơn vị học trình của các mơn thiếu điểm </b>
trên 25 (sinh viên ở lại lớp)


<b>55. Cho biết những sinh viên có Điểm TK các mơn học <3 (ở lại lớp).</b>
<b>56. Cho biết tên sinh viên KHƠNG thiếu mơn học nào</b>


<b>57. Cho biết tên sinh viên học TẤT CẢ các mơn học</b>


<b>58. Cho biết tên sinh viên học ít nhất hai mơn có mã ‘001’ và ‘002’</b>
<b>59. Cho biết tên sinh viên có điểm mơn ‘001’ cao nhất.</b>


</div>

<!--links-->

×